Uninhabitable planets are planets that are not suitable for human habitation (or any similar humanoid, or carbon-based lifeform for that matter). Many uninhabitable worlds have a population that live on biodomes or equivalent habitats that protect them from harsh conditions, or to give them breathable air in planets with a toxic (or no) atmosphere.
Uninhabitable planets may meet some or even nearly all of the criteria for Yatalike planets, but are still barred from semi-habitable status due to the sixth, and arguably most important criterion - that it must be habitable in the first place.
